Passenger identity verification processes

Passenger identity verification processes are fundamental components of secure passenger boarding procedures, aimed at ensuring that only authorized individuals gain access to the aircraft. These processes involve multiple steps designed to accurately confirm each passenger’s identity before boarding.

Typically, passengers are required to present valid identification documents, such as a passport or national ID card, which are checked against airline and security records. This verification is often complemented by electronic databases or biometric systems for rapid confirmation, especially at high-volume airports.

Modern secure passenger boarding procedures increasingly incorporate biometric verification technologies, including fingerprint scans and facial recognition. These tools enhance accuracy and speed, reducing the risk of identity fraud and improving overall security during boarding.

Screening of carry-on and checked luggage

Screening of carry-on and checked luggage is a fundamental component of secure passenger boarding procedures. It involves the use of advanced imaging technologies and detection methods to identify potential threats before passengers reach the aircraft. This process helps prevent dangerous items from entering the secure zone.

Carry-on luggage is typically subjected to multiple screening layers, including X-ray scanners and explosive trace detection devices. These tools allow security personnel to detect concealed hazardous materials swiftly and accurately. Consistent inspection of cabin baggage ensures that prohibited items do not compromise flight safety.

Checked luggage also undergoes thorough screening, often through explosive detection systems and, where necessary, manual searches. This process aims to identify explosive devices, firearms, or other banned items that could threaten aviation security. Ensuring the integrity of checked baggage screening strengthens the overall security framework.

The effectiveness of luggage screening relies on strict adherence to protocols, trained security staff, and complementary technological advancements. Regular updates and maintenance of screening equipment are vital to maintaining high security standards, reaffirming the importance of secure passenger boarding procedures in aviation security compliance.

Use of biometric verification technologies

Biometric verification technologies utilize unique physiological or behavioral traits to confirm passenger identities during the boarding process. These systems include fingerprint recognition, facial recognition, iris scanning, and voice authentication, which enhance security and reduce the risk of identity fraud.

Implementing biometric verification in secure passenger boarding procedures provides a rapid and contactless method for passenger identification, streamlining the boarding process while maintaining high security standards. This aligns with international aviation security protocols by accurately verifying travelers against official identity documents.

Furthermore, biometric systems can seamlessly integrate with existing security infrastructure, allowing real-time data processing and access control. This reduces false positives and minimizes delays, thereby improving passenger experience and operational efficiency. However, strict data protection policies are critical to address privacy concerns and ensure compliance with legal standards.

Common vulnerabilities and threats

Several vulnerabilities can compromise secure passenger boarding procedures, exposing airports and airlines to potential threats. One common vulnerability involves the impersonation of authorized passengers through identity fraud or document forgery. Malicious actors may present fake identification documents, evading verification processes if checks are insufficient.

Another significant threat arises from luggage screening lapses. Luggage may contain dangerous items or prohibited substances if security protocols are bypassed or improperly executed. Overlooking suspicious items or misplacing carry-on checks can create vulnerabilities in the overall security chain.

Additionally, technological vulnerabilities are notable. Biometric verification systems, while advanced, may be susceptible to hacking or spoofing if not properly secured. Cybersecurity gaps can allow unauthorized access or manipulation, undermining the integrity of passenger identification.

Overall, understanding these vulnerabilities is essential for enhancing secure passenger boarding procedures. Addressing these risks with robust technologies, strict adherence to protocols, and continuous staff training helps mitigate potential security threats during boarding.

Future Trends in Secure Passenger Boarding Procedures

Advancements in technology are set to significantly transform secure passenger boarding procedures. Biometric systems, such as facial recognition and fingerprint scanning, are anticipated to streamline identity verification, reducing wait times while enhancing security. These innovations enable real-time passenger matching against secure databases, ensuring rapid and accurate screening.

Artificial intelligence (AI) and machine learning will play an increasingly vital role in threat detection and anomaly identification. By analyzing vast amounts of security data, AI can identify suspicious behaviors or patterns that may escape traditional screening methods, thereby strengthening overall security measures during boarding processes.

Furthermore, the integration of mobile and contactless technologies promises to make boarding more efficient. Digital boarding passes, mobile biometric authentication, and biometric-enabled e-boarding gates are expected to minimize physical contact and reduce congestion, aligning with health safety considerations and operational efficiency. These future trends aim to enhance the effectiveness of secure passenger boarding procedures within the framework of aviation security compliance.
